Output 17ecbb101e3f8435eeafea1bbf2df8b6f3b723c2e0c6fa700d2afebed3cd2bf8:1

value
30975173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c28cf1b2c17b46c325f0ded59cf0258ae8ef47e OP_EQUAL
address
3QgK6Lwb46Y5ySXRWiSaXnAQggL8cs1tvF
transaction
17ecbb101e3f8435eeafea1bbf2df8b6f3b723c2e0c6fa700d2afebed3cd2bf8
spent
true